Roy Nelson: “Brock Lesnar would come back to fight Frank Mir, it’s the only fight he thinks he could win”
“Ultimate Fighter” season ten winner, Roy Nelson has continued to poke former UFC heavyweight champion, Brock Lesnar with a rather large stick this week in an attempt to goad him into returning to the octagon to face him, claiming the only person the Minnesota native would happily return to face is Frank Mir because it’s the only fight he knows he can win.
Speaking via Inside MMA, Nelson said:
“You know what? Brock coming back, if he does come back, I would love to welcome him back to the UFC. That was a fight that I actually called him out on ESPN, before. But if they actually make him come back, or if he actually thinks about coming back, he’ll probably come back to fight Frank Mir, because I think that’s the only fight he thinks he can win. But, you know what? I would love to have that fight with Brock.”
Nelson is coming off a impressive first minute knockout win over Dave Herman on the recent UFC 146 card in Las Vegas, Nevada, an event Lesnar attended in person for the first time since hanging up his gloves late last year.
